OverviewWho's lurking in the foggy forest? Look through the trees and guess the shapes to find out! What can that be in the foggy, foggy forest? Whether it’s a fairy queen on a trampoline, three brown bears on picnic chairs, or an ogre doing yoga, children will love trying to guess what each foggy silhouette will be. Take a trip through the mysterious misty landscape – hilarious fairytale fun lies around every corner. Table of ContentsReviews‘children will love to hear this over and over again’ * Early year's Educator * 'children will love to hear this over and over again' Early year's Educator Author InformationNick Sharratt is a popular children's book artist, well known for illustrating the books of Jacqueline Wilson. He has also written and illustrated many of his own books including My Mum and Dad Make Me Laugh (9780744594997) and What's in the Witch's Kitchen? (9781406322279) as well as Eat Your Peas, which won the 2001 Children's Book Award and Pants, which won the picture book category of the 2003 Children's Book Award. Nick lives in Brighton.
